1. INTRODUCTION
Viking supervised VXD Single-Interlocked Preaction Systems utilize a Viking
Model VXD Deluge Valve and a pneumatically pressurized automatic sprinkler
system. This feature helps prevent undetected leaks. Single-Interlocked Preaction
Systems are commonly used where the sprinkler system piping and/or sprinkler
may be subject to damage. If the system piping or a sprinkler is damaged,
supervisory pressure is reduced and a “low air” supervisory is activated. The
electrically controlled preaction systems include an electric solenoid valve
controlled by an approved release control panel (sold separately) with compatible
detection system (sold separately). In fire conditions, when the detection system
operates, the system release control panel energizes the solenoid valve open,
causing the deluge valve to open. The sprinkler system fills with water. If any
sprinklers have opened, water will flow from the system. If sprinklers have not
opened, water will be in the sprinkler system piping when the sprinkler operates.
A sprinkler must open before water flows from the system.
2. LISTINGS AND APPROVALS
cULus Listed - Categories VLFT and VLFT7
FM Approved

Overview

The Viking Model VXD Single-Interlocked Preaction System with Electric Release is a fire protection system designed to prevent undetected leaks and provide controlled water discharge in the event of a fire. It utilizes a Viking Model VXD Deluge Valve and a pneumatically pressurized automatic sprinkler system.

Function Description:

This system is primarily used in environments where sprinkler piping or sprinklers may be susceptible to damage. In its normal "SET" condition, water supply pressure is maintained in the priming chamber of the deluge valve through a priming line, which includes a normally open priming valve, strainer, restricted orifice, and check valve. This pressure holds the deluge valve diaphragm closed, keeping the outlet chamber and system piping dry.

In fire conditions, an approved release control panel, connected to a compatible detection system, energizes a normally closed solenoid valve, causing it to open. This releases pressure from the priming chamber faster than it can be supplied, leading to the deluge valve diaphragm opening. Water then flows into the system piping and alarm devices, activating water motor alarms and/or water flow alarms. Water will discharge from any open sprinklers or spray nozzles. If no sprinklers have opened, water will fill the sprinkler system piping, but discharge will only occur once a sprinkler opens.

In trouble conditions, such as a sprinkler opening before detection system operation or a loss of supervisory pressure in the sprinkler piping, a low air pressure condition will be signaled by the air supervisory switch. However, the deluge valve will NOT open. If the detection system operates due to mechanical damage or malfunction, the deluge valve will open, but water will be contained within the sprinkler piping, and alarms will activate.

Manual operation is possible by pulling the emergency release, which releases pressure from the priming chamber and opens the deluge valve, allowing water to flow into the system piping and from any open sprinklers/nozzles.

Important Technical Specifications:

  • Nominal Sizes Available: 1-1/2", 2", 2-1/2", 3", 4", 6", 8", 10".
  • Part Numbers (Loose Trim):
    • Galvanized: 23562-1 (1-1/2"), 23583-1 (2"), 23604-1 (2-1/2"), 23625-1 (3"), 23646-1 (4"), 23668-1 (6"), 23689-1 (8"), 23750-1 (10").
    • Brass: 23562-2 (1-1/2"), 23583-2 (2"), 23604-2 (2-1/2"), 23625-2 (3"), 23646-2 (4"), 23668-2 (6"), 23689-2 (8"), 23750-2 (10").
  • Part Numbers (Pre-trimmed Galvanized): 23563 (1-1/2"), 23584 (2"), 23605 (2-1/2"), 23626 (3"), 23647 (4"), 23669 (6"), 23690 (8"), 23751 (10").
  • Recommended Supervisory Pressure: 20 PSI (1.4 bar) in closed sprinkler piping.
  • Air Supervisory Switch Activation: Set to activate at 15 PSI (1.03 bar) on pressure drop.
  • Alarm Pressure Switch Activation: Activates when pressurized to 4 to 8 PSI (0.3 to 0.6 bar) on pressure rise.
  • Air Supply Compressor Sizing: Must be sized to establish total required air pressure in 30 minutes.
  • Listings and Approvals: cULus Listed (Categories VLFT and VLFT7), FM Approved.

Usage Features:

  • Single-Interlocked Operation: Requires both the detection system to operate and a sprinkler to open for water discharge, preventing accidental water release.
  • Leak Prevention: Pneumatically pressurized sprinkler system helps prevent undetected leaks.
  • Electric Release: Utilizes an electric solenoid valve controlled by a release control panel for reliable activation.
  • Manual Override: Emergency release valve allows for manual activation of the system.
  • Dry System Piping: Keeps the sprinkler piping dry until activation, reducing the risk of water damage from accidental discharge.

Maintenance Features:

  • Weekly Visual Inspection: Recommended to check the main water supply control valve, other valves, and for signs of mechanical damage, leakage, or corrosion.
  • Quarterly Water Flow Alarm Test: Involves opening the alarm test valve to verify local electric and mechanical water motor alarms, and remote station alarm signals.
  • Quarterly Main Drain Test: Involves recording water supply pressure, fully opening and slowly closing the flow test valve, and comparing results to previous data.
  • Annual Trip Test: A critical test that involves operating a detector to trip the system, allowing full water flow. This test requires precautions to prevent damage as water will flow into the sprinkler piping and from any open sprinklers/nozzles.
  • Maintenance After Each Operation: Includes inspecting the entire system for damage, replacing release devices/sprinklers, flushing the system if exposed to corrosive water, and performing semi-annual maintenance.
  • Semi-Annual Maintenance: Involves removing the system from service, closing control valves, relieving priming chamber pressure, inspecting and cleaning all trim for corrosion/blockage, and cleaning/replacing strainer screens.
  • Every Fifth Year Inspection: Recommended for internal inspection of Deluge Valves, strainers, and restricted orifices, unless more frequent inspections are indicated by tests.
  • Air Supply Maintenance: The air supply must be regulated, restricted, and maintained automatically, with the air maintenance device regulating and restricting supervisory air flow.
  • Documentation: Requires recording and providing notification of inspection results to the Authority Having Jurisdiction.
